US combat troops must leave Iraq by the end of the year, US and Iraqi officials are expected to say within the next few days. "We don't need any more fighters because we have those," Iraqi Foreign Minister Fuad Hussein told The Wall Street Journal. "What do we need? We need cooperation in the field of intelligence. We need help with training. We need troops to help us in the air," he added. Senior officials from Baghdad were in Washington on Thursday for preliminary talks on the US military presence in Iraq, ahead of an upcoming meeting between leaders of the two countries, the Pentagon said in a statement.
